Sodexo Ltd is seeking a Health & Safety Manager to influence safety culture within Schools & Universities. This role involves leading food safety strategies, managing incidents, and supporting operational teams to comply with safety standards.
Candidates should have:
- A Level 4 Food Safety qualification
- A NEBOSH General Certificate
- Strong communication and analytical skills
The position offers a salary up to £50,000 plus benefits, including a company car and bonus. It requires some travel across various locations.
